SB854: Risky Research Review Act

Legislative Summary

A bill to amend title 31, United States Code, to establish the Life Sciences Research Security Board, and for other purposes.

Bill History

3/5/2025
Read twice and referred to the Committee on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s.
Senate
7/30/2025
Committee on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s. Ordered to be reported without amendment favorably.
Senate
9/17/2025
Committee on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s. Reported by Senator Paul without amendment. Without written report.
Senate
9/17/2025
Placed on Senate Legislative Calendar under General Orders. Calendar No. 164.
Senate
